
How MP4 to F4V Conversion Works
The MPEG-4 Part 14 Video format packages H.264 or H.265 video with AAC audio in a container format widely supported across every platform and device. Converting to F4V produces a video file that stores data in the F4V format. This conversion changes the file's encoding, compression method, and supported feature set. Metadata such as creation date and embedded colour profiles is preserved where the target format supports it.
